Children's Day in Nigeria is a public holiday dedicated to celebrating children and promoting their rights. It is observed annually on May 27th and serves as a reminder of the importance of nurturing and protecting the future generation.

On Children's Day, schools and communities organize various activities such as parades, cultural performances, and games to honor children. Families often take their children out for special treats, and many organizations hold events to raise awareness about children's rights and welfare.

What activities are commonly held on Children's Day in Nigeria?
Common activities include school parades, cultural dances, and competitions. Many communities also organize fun fairs and educational workshops for children.
Is Children's Day a public holiday in Nigeria?
Yes, Children's Day is a public holiday in Nigeria, allowing families and communities to celebrate together. Schools are usually closed, giving children a day off to enjoy the festivities.
How do parents typically celebrate Children's Day with their children?
Parents often take their children out for special meals, gifts, or outings to amusement parks. It's a day for families to bond and create lasting memories while emphasizing the importance of children's rights.
